What Is Trickle Vents Implementation in Whitechapel - E1?
Trickle vents are small controllable vents fitted into window frames that allow a steady “trickle” of fresh air into a room. They help reduce moisture build-up and improve ventilation without having to keep windows open.

Why Trickle Vents Are Important for Your Home
Many Whitechapel - E1 homes suffer from condensation because warm moist air has nowhere to go. Drying clothes indoors, cooking, showering, and even breathing adds moisture to the air. Without aeration, moisture can settle on cold surfaces like windows and external walls.
Trickle vents provide background ventilation that helps balance humidity, reduce water droplets, and support healthier indoor air. They’re a simple Improvement that can make rooms feel fresher and help prevent mould.
Helps reduce water droplets on windows and damp patches around frames.
Improved Breeze makes it harder for fungus to grow in corners and behind furniture.
Fresh air without fully opening windows — especially useful in winter.
